C语言中的函数:函数的定义,就是一个封装的代码段,每个函数能实现不同的功能定义函数的目的:将一个常用的共功能封装起来,方便以后调用什么情况下需要定义函数:添加一个常用的新功能定义函数的格式:返回值类型函数名(形式参数列表){函数体;}形参跟实参:形式参数:定义..
分类:
编程语言 时间:
2014-12-27 06:44:36
阅读次数:
237
函数:完成特定功能代码块函数作用:管理代码的函数的优点:提高代码的可读性 提高代码的复用性 提高代码可维护性函数:函数名不可以重复定义 要给函数起一个有意义的名字函数特点:只有调用才会执行函数定义的格式 形参列表 返回类型 函数名称(参数类...
分类:
编程语言 时间:
2014-12-27 01:33:08
阅读次数:
222
值参数方法被调用时系统做如下操作:1.在栈中为形参分配空间;2.将实参的值复制给形参;在变量用作实参前,变量必须要被赋值(除非是输出参数),对于引用类型,变量可以被设置为一个实际的引用或null。namespace ConsoleApplication1{ class A { ...
分类:
其他好文 时间:
2014-12-26 12:31:11
阅读次数:
136
目录:PHP学习笔记——1.变量PHP学习笔记——2.常量PHP学习笔记——3.运算符PHP学习笔记——4.控制结构PHP学习笔记——5.函数1.概念 从编程的角度, 将若干语句封装在一起,取个名字 再依据名称进行调用,即为函数2.声明及调用 function abc(形参) { ... ...
分类:
Web程序 时间:
2014-12-25 21:58:14
阅读次数:
201
今天用到了二维数组作为参数传递的程序,通过网上搜索,针对自己遇到的问题做个整理。1、在被调用函数的形参数组定义可以省略第一维的大小,第二维不可省略,如下:voidfun(inta[5][20]);//合法voidfun(inta[][20]);//合法voidfun(inta[5][]);//不合法voidfun(inta[][]);//不合..
分类:
编程语言 时间:
2014-12-24 18:21:24
阅读次数:
248
形参个数: arguments.callee.length或者 ?函数名.length ? ,arguments.callee就是取得函数名 实参个数: arguments.length 因此 function fun(a, b, c){ ????if(?arguments.callee.length ==?arguments...
分类:
Web程序 时间:
2014-12-24 16:29:02
阅读次数:
221
(function(){
???var?a?=?10,?b?=?2;
???a?=?a?+?b;
???b?=?a?-?b;
???a?=?a?-?b;
???alert(a+"?"+b);
})();
(function(){
???var?a?=?10,b=2;
???a?=?a^b;
???...
分类:
其他好文 时间:
2014-12-24 13:35:27
阅读次数:
149
优先级运算符名称或含义使用形式结合方向说明1[]数组下标数组名[常量表达式]左到右()圆括号(表达式)/函数名(形参表).成员选择(对象)对象.成员名->成员选择(指针)对象指针->成员名2-负号运算符-表达式右到左单目运算符(类型)强制类型转换(数据类型)表达式++自增运算符++变量名/变量名++...
分类:
编程语言 时间:
2014-12-24 13:28:08
阅读次数:
203
在模板定义语法中关键字class与typename的作用完全一样。什么是类模板如果一个类中数据成员的数据类型不能确定,或者是某个成员函数的参数或返回值的类型不能确定,就必须将此类声明为模板类模板定义Step1: 声明模板三种声明形式:1。基本模板类template2。带默认类型形参template3...
分类:
编程语言 时间:
2014-12-24 06:24:06
阅读次数:
201
一、函数的定义(1)函数的定义格式1 func 函数名(形参列表) -> 返回值类型 {2 // 函数体...3 4 }(2)形参列表的格式形参名1: 形参类型1, 形参名2: 形参类型2, …(3)举例:计算2个整数的和1 func sum(num1: Int, num2: Int) -...
分类:
移动开发 时间:
2014-12-22 17:53:20
阅读次数:
391